Things to do in Flagstaff?Flagstaff, Arizona is a stunning city located in the Southwest region of the United States. Home to attractions such as Walnut Canyon National Monument and Lowell Observatory, visitors can explore outdoor activities and history when visiting Flagstaff. There are also plenty of museums, galleries, and performance venues such as the Museum of Northern Arizona and Flagstaff Symphony Orchestra. For entertainment, visitors can explore boutique shops and restaurants along with movie theaters and live music clubs.
